At its core, a crash game involves watching a multiplier increase over time. Players place a bet and continuously observe as the multiplier climbs. The longer the game continues without crashing, the higher the multiplier, and therefore, the larger the potential payout. However, at any given moment, the multiplier can “crash,” resulting in a loss of the initial bet. The key to winning lies in predicting when to cash out – taking a profit before the inevitable crash. This requires a blend of luck, strategy, and disciplined risk management, turning each round into a tense and exciting gamble. It's a game of probabilities and psychological endurance, where timing is everything.
Understanding the Mechanics of Crash Games
The fundamental principle behind crash games relies on a provably fair random number generator (RNG). This system ensures transparency and eliminates the possibility of manipulation by the game provider. Before each round begins, the RNG generates a server seed and the player generates a client seed. These seeds are combined to determine the point at which the multiplier will crash. Players can often verify the fairness of the game by reviewing the generated seeds and confirming the outcome. This transparency builds trust and assures players that the results are not predetermined, unlike some traditional casino games. The best platforms will offer detailed explanations of their provably fair system, allowing players to independently verify the integrity of each game round.
The Role of the Auto Cash Out Feature
Most crash game platforms offer an “auto cash out” feature. This is an invaluable tool for players, allowing them to pre-set a multiplier at which their bet will automatically be cashed out. Without this feature, manually clicking the cash out button at the precise moment can be incredibly difficult, especially with the pressure of a rapidly increasing multiplier. Utilizing auto cash out removes the element of human error and allows players to consistently execute their strategies. It is, however, crucial to set the auto cash out multiplier judiciously, balancing the desire for a larger payout with the increased risk of a crash occurring before that target is reached. Carefully consider your risk tolerance and adjust your auto cash out settings accordingly.

Developing Effective Crash Game Strategies
While crash games rely heavily on chance, implementing a well-thought-out strategy can significantly improve your odds of success. One popular approach is the Martingale system, where you double your bet after each loss, aiming to recover previous losses with a single win. However, this strategy requires a substantial bankroll and can quickly lead to significant losses if a long losing streak occurs. Another strategy involves setting a target profit and a stop-loss limit, allowing you to walk away with a gain or minimize your losses. Consistent bankroll management is paramount. Never bet more than you can afford to lose, and avoid chasing losses, which can lead to impulsive and irrational decisions. A disciplined approach is crucial for long-term profitability.
The Importance of Bankroll Management
Effective bankroll management is, without question, the cornerstone of any successful crash game strategy. Before you begin playing, determine a specific amount of money you are willing to risk, and strictly adhere to that limit. A common recommendation is to allocate no more than 1-2% of your bankroll to each individual bet. This helps to cushion against potential losing streaks and prevents you from depleting your funds too quickly. Equally important is setting a stop-loss limit – a predetermined amount of money you will stop playing once you reach that loss. This prevents you from falling into the trap of chasing losses, which often leads to even greater financial setbacks. Disciplined bankroll management isn’t glamorous, but it’s essential for sustainable play.
